Partage via


Commandes et paramètres

S'applique à : .NET Framework .NET .NET Standard

Télécharger ADO.NET

Après avoir établi une connexion à une source de données, vous pouvez exécuter des commandes et retourner les résultats de la source de données à l'aide d'un objet DbCommand. Vous pouvez créer une commande à l’aide de l’un des constructeurs de commande pour le Fournisseur de données Microsoft SqlClient pour SQL Server. Les constructeurs acceptent des arguments optionnels, comme une instruction SQL à exécuter au niveau de la source de données, un objet DbConnection ou un objet DbTransaction.

Vous pouvez également configurer ces objets en tant que propriétés de la commande. Vous pouvez aussi créer une commande pour une connexion particulière à l'aide de la méthode CreateCommand d'un objet DbConnection. L'instruction SQL en cours d'exécution par la commande peut être configurée à l'aide de la propriété CommandText. Le Fournisseur de données Microsoft SqlClient pour SQL Server a le projet SqlCommand.

Dans cette section

Exécution d’une commande
Décrit l'objet Command et son utilisation pour exécuter des requêtes et des commandes sur une source de données.

Configuration des paramètres
Décrit l'utilisation des paramètres Command, y compris la direction, les types de données et la syntaxe des paramètres.

Génération de commandes avec CommandBuilders
Décrit l'utilisation de générateurs de commande pour générer automatiquement les commandes INSERT, UPDATE et DELETE pour un DataAdapter ayant une commande SELECT d'analyse unique.

Obtention d’une valeur unique dans une base de données
Décrit comment utiliser la méthode ExecuteScalar d'un objet Command pour retourner une valeur unique à partir d'une requête de base de données.

Utilisation des commandes pour modifier les données
Décrit comment utiliser le Fournisseur de données Microsoft SqlClient pour SQL Server pour exécuter des procédures stockées ou des instructions du langage de définition de données (DDL).

Voir aussi